Skip to main content

Source code revision

svn

summary: -------- 1 -------- (1) Made CLIProcessExecutor pkg-private
revision: 19199
author: bnevins
date: 2008-03-24 19:21:34 UTC (7 years)
message: -------- 1 --------
(1) Made CLIProcessExecutor pkg-private
(2) Threw away the stream-draining class inside (1)
(3) Start and Stop Database use the new API for (1) -- namely a name for the process-draining threads is passed in.

I have a pet peeve about unnamed threads. thread dumps are confusing enough as it is. The stream-draining threads are named so
that it is obvious what they are doing.

This portion is a bugfix. Non-daemon process draining threads prevented the CLI JVM from exiting.

--------------- 2 ------------

Jerome graciously moved classes from DOL and KERNEL into common-utils, so I removed the dependencies...




Change Path Actions
M trunk/v3/admin/cli/pom.xml
M trunk/v3/admin/cli/src/main/java/com/sun/enterprise/admin/cli/CLIProcessExecutor.java
M trunk/v3/admin/cli/src/main/java/com/sun/enterprise/admin/cli/StartDatabaseCommand.java
M trunk/v3/admin/cli/src/main/java/com/sun/enterprise/admin/cli/StopDatabaseCommand.java
 
 
Close
loading
Please Confirm
Close